The hexadecimal color code #9BCE56 corresponds to the code RGB( 155, 206, 86 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,61 level), green (at 0,81 level) and blue (at 0,34 level). Its brightness is 57% and its saturation is 55%. It is composed of red at 34%, green at 46% and blue at 19%.

Uses of #9BCE56 in CSS

When using #9BCE56 as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#9BCE56 as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
